Here's how it would actually go down:

Victim: "Honey, call 911. Tell them I am armed and am detaining the suspect of an attempted knife attack. Describe what I look like."

LEO to Victim: "Put your weapon down and step back towards my voice." (Victin complies)

LEO's partner to knife attacker: "Lay down on the ground, hands on top of your head."

After both are cuffed, they'll sort things out then. Whatever you do, never take your firearm off the perp except to lay it on the ground under the direction of the law enforcement officer. If he's super cool, he may tell you to holster it, but don't count on it - even if you're his next-door neighbor.
